Our Battle Plan for the Allianz Hunt. 

1. Touch N Go Card

Quite essential part of travelling around Kuala Lumpur using the LRT. This would save us time buying the coins from the machine which is usually occupied with people. With a simple touch of a card, travelling around could be so much faster. 

2. Smartphone + Waze 

Moving around KL could be quite confusing. Hence, included in our battle plan are two more essential items we will be needing, a smartphone and an application called Waze. Through the utilization of this amazing application with a high powered smartphone, hopefully this will able us to get around KL much more easier.

3. LRT Map + Tour around surrounding area. 


Of course this would involve some studying. (Sighs) However, with a proper understanding of the map beforehand, this would again enable us to move around KL much more easier. Thus, we would be carrying printouts of the map to plan our journey before and along the way while we are commuting as well. Besides that, we were also planning for a tour around the surrounding area of the Allianz Arena and KL as well since we are all not from KL.
